The Different Types of Viking Stoves
Viking stoves come in different types, each with unique features and functionalities. Here are the different types of Viking stoves:
- Gas Viking Stoves: The most popular type uses natural gas or propane as their fuel source and provides instant heat that can be easily adjusted.
- Electric Viking Stoves: These stoves use electricity as their fuel source and are known for their even heat distribution.
- Dual Fuel Viking Stoves: These types combine the best gas and electric stoves. They use gas for the cooktop and electricity for the oven.
- Induction Viking Stoves: These stoves use electromagnetic fields to heat the cookware.
Factors to Consider When Choosing a Viking Stove
Choosing the right Viking stove for your kitchen can be overwhelming, especially if you don’t know what to look for. Here are the factors to consider when choosing a Viking stove:
- Size and Cooking Capacity: The size of the Viking stove you choose should depend on the size of your kitchen and the amount of cooking you do. If you have a large family or frequently entertain guests, you should consider a larger Viking stove with more burners and a larger oven capacity.
- Fuel Type: A gas Viking stove is the best option if you prefer cooking with gas. If you prefer even heat distribution, an electric or dual-fuel Viking stove is the way to go. An induction Viking stove is the best choice if you want an eco-friendly option.
- Burner Configuration: The burner configuration of a Viking stove determines the cooking options available to you. Depending on the model, Viking stoves come with different burner configurations, from four to six burners.
- Design and Style: Viking stoves come in different designs and styles, from the classic Viking look to the more contemporary style. Choosing a Viking stove that complements your kitchen décor and personal style would be best.
- Additional Features: Viking stoves include convection cooking, built-in grills, and self-cleaning ovens. You should consider the additional features of each model and choose one that suits your cooking needs.
